Redux
文章平均质量分 94
超悠閒
博客文章倉庫:https://github.com/superfreeeee/Blog
博客代码仓库:https://github.com/superfreeeee/Blog-code
展开
-
细说 Redux Toolkit 2 : 基础用法
介绍 Redux Toolkit 核心 API 和写法示例,并于原生 Redux 做对比原创 2022-10-07 17:25:27 · 1155 阅读 · 0 评论 -
细说 Redux Toolkit 1 : 重新回顾 Redux
重新梳理 Redux 数据流于重要核心概念原创 2022-10-03 14:41:41 · 727 阅读 · 0 评论 -
Redux 应用: 在 React 中使用 redux 的 3 种 方式 + 异步更新 + 中间件(TS实现)
React 应用: 在 React 中使用 redux 的 3 种 方式 + 异步更新 + 中间件(TS实现)文章目录React 应用: 在 React 中使用 redux 的 3 种 方式 + 异步更新 + 中间件(TS实现)前言正文0. 依赖管理1. Redux 全局状态对象定义1.1 Reducer 更新函数1.2 actionCreator 更新函数工厂方法1.3 store 创建全局状态中心2. 基础用法(同步状态更新)2.1 直接使用 store 对象本身2.1.1 store 自带 API2原创 2021-07-10 13:06:44 · 746 阅读 · 1 评论 -
Redux 源码解析(三): compose & applyMiddleware API
Redux 源码解析(三): compose & applyMiddleware API文章目录Redux 源码解析(三): compose & applyMiddleware API前言正文1. compose 源码解析1.1 方法签名1.2 源码实现2. applyMiddleware 源码解析2.1 类型定义2.2 方法签名2.3 源码实现结语其他资源参考连接阅读笔记参考前言Redux 源码系列转眼间就来到最后一篇了,本篇要来介绍最后剩下的两个 API:compose 和 app原创 2021-09-02 00:01:32 · 200 阅读 · 0 评论 -
Redux 源码解析(二): bindActionCreators & combineReducers API
Redux 码解析(二): bindActionCreators & combineReducers API文章目录Redux 码解析(二): bindActionCreators & combineReducers API前言正文1. bindActionCreators 源码解析1.1 类型定义1.2 导出方法签名1.3 源码实现2. combineReducers 源码解析2.1 使用背景2.2 类型定义2.3 导出方法签名2.4 源码实现结语其他资源参考连接阅读笔记参考前言今天原创 2021-09-01 08:11:38 · 195 阅读 · 0 评论 -
Redux 源码解析: 从源码的角度了解 redux-thunk 到底怎么用
Redux 源码解析: 从源码的角度了解 redux-thunk 到底怎么用文章目录Redux 源码解析: 从源码的角度了解 redux-thunk 到底怎么用前言正文1. 源码解析1.1 (复习)Redux 中间件1.2 redux-thunk 源码1.3 Action、ActionCreator 类型定义1.3.1 Action 类型(redux 源码)1.3.2 ActionCreator 类型(redux 源码)1.4 bindActionCreators 类型定义 & 源码1.4.1 b原创 2021-08-08 17:16:52 · 238 阅读 · 0 评论 -
React Redux 进阶: Hooks 版本用法 & Custom Context 局部 Store 实践
React Redux 进阶: Hooks 版本用法 & Custom Context 局部 Store 实践文章目录React Redux 进阶: Hooks 版本用法 & Custom Context 局部 Store 实践前言正文1. 在函数组件内消费 Redux 数据1.1 Redux 全局状态定义1.2 使用 Hooks 消费 Redux 数据2. Custom Context 实现局部 store2.1 HeaderStore 局部状态定义2.2 消费局部 store结语其他资原创 2021-08-29 16:30:55 · 694 阅读 · 0 评论 -
Redux 源码解析(一): createStore API
Redux 源码解析(一): createStore API文章目录Redux 源码解析(一): createStore API前言正文0. 背景知识0.1 源代码版本:4.1.1, TS 实现0.2 源码目录结构1. createStore 源码解析1.1 导出类型1.2 状态 & 返回1.3 预处理1.4 获取状态 getState1.5 订阅状态 subscribe1.6 修改状态 dispatch1.7 置换核心函数 replaceReducer结语其他资源参考连接阅读笔记参考前言在原创 2021-08-31 00:46:44 · 493 阅读 · 0 评论